Objective: The aim of this study was to review the outcomes of facial nerve rehabilitation and identify factors that may affect rehabilitation in these patients.Methods: Twenty-four patients underwent facial nerve anastomosis or grafting between 1998 and 2013.The following data were obtained: patient age and sex, preoperative diagnosis and facial nerve status, administration of radiation,surgical procedure performed (including type and length of graft), proximal and distal sites of anastomosis, time interval to first recovery of clinical facial nerve function, and facial nerve status at most recent follow-up.Functional outcomes were assessed with the House-Brackmann grading system.
